Hoi An Cam Thanh water coconut village Basket Boat experience
Follow Us as Jim shares with you his recent visit to the Water Coconut Village to experience the basket boat ride in Hoi An - Cam Thanh. Check out how a leisure ride quickly culminated into a thrill ride with endless spinning that would probably send one flying out of the boat if one does not hang on tightly for dear life. Definitely not for the faint-hearted!!!
A little travel tip for you if you plan to visit the Cam Thanh water Coconut Village soon. You can save half the time and money if you visit the village on your own. All you need to do is to key in the address in your Grab (hired car) app with the following address:

My Son Sanctuary Bike Tour - Hoi An, Vietnam
HALF-DAY BIKE TOUR IN HOI AN
Cycle the scenic countryside from Hoi An to the UNESCO World Heritage site of My Son on this half-day biking adventure.
My Son Sanctuary is a cluster of abandoned and partially ruined Hindu temples constructed between the 4th and the 14th century AD by the Cham people. As of 1999, My Son has been recognized by UNESCO as a world heritage site.
The Champa Kingdom, Indianized maritime kingdom based in what is now the Central Coast of Vietnam, was eventually conquered by the Vietnamese and Khmer. Descendants of the original tribes are now scattered throughout the region, mostly along inland waterways.

Cycling to Hội An from Da Nang, Vietnam Travel VLOG 07
Welcome to part 7 of my Vietnam Travel VLOG! In today's episode, we traveled by bus from Hue to Da Nang, which is where we will be staying for the next few days. After checking into our hotel and checking the weather, we decided to rent some bicycles and cycle to the nearby town and tourist attraction, Hội An.
Hội An is about 30 km away from Da Nang, and it was one of the top places on our list of must-go locations. Rather than taking a taxi or bus, which is a popular option, we decided to go by bicycle, since it was a straight shot all along the same road along the ocean.
Here's a link to our cycling route for the day.
After arriving, we checked out what Hội An had to offer, and we were not disappointed. The main roads are blocked off from vehicles, so it's much quieter and cleaner, and the architecture and overall atmosphere is absolutely stunning. Both during day time and even more so during night time.
